Norton Carnegie Tabbed ECC Men's Soccer
Defensive Player of the Week

            DOBBS FERRY, NY - Mercy College senior defender Norton Carnegie (Kingston, Jamaica) has been named East Coast Conference (ECC) Men's Soccer Defensive Player of the Week. He is the second Flyer to earn a weekly honor from the league this year, following Santiago Riera's (Valhalla, NY) Rookie of the Week selection on September 11.

            Carnegie anchored Mercy's defense that shut down top scoring threat Gerald Jones and posted a 1-0 shutout of ECC foe St. Thomas Aquinas on Tuesday.  Both Mercy and St. Thomas Aquinas were ranked in last week's NSCAA Northeast Regional poll.

            The Flyers are currently 3-2-0 overall and 1-0-0 in ECC play.  Carnegie has played a key role in Mercy's backfield this year, helping the squad allow only six goals in five games.  Mercy returns to action on Wednesday, September 27, at Molloy.
